A Joyful Anthem of Unity and Peace

Xuxa's song "Nuestro Canto de Paz" is a vibrant and uplifting anthem that celebrates the power of music to bring people together. The lyrics express a deep sense of joy and excitement about singing and sharing energy with others. The repeated phrase "Io, io, io, ia" adds a playful and infectious rhythm, inviting everyone to join in the celebration. The song emphasizes the idea that music can reconnect us and spread happiness to the world, highlighting its universal appeal and ability to transcend barriers.

The imagery of children dancing, playing, jumping, and singing together paints a picture of a harmonious and joyful community. This scene symbolizes innocence, unity, and the pure joy of being together. The lyrics suggest that in this shared experience, everyone is equal, and the collective joy creates a sense of belonging and togetherness. The heart "exploding with so much joy" is a powerful metaphor for the overwhelming happiness that comes from being part of a united and celebratory group.

The chorus, with its call-and-response structure, reinforces the theme of unity and collective action. When Xuxa sings "Si canto así" and the people respond, it signifies a communal effort to create peace through music. The repetition of "Nuestro canto de paz" (Our song of peace) underscores the song's message that peace is achievable when people come together in harmony. The song's joyful and inclusive tone makes it a powerful anthem for peace, encouraging listeners to believe in the possibility of a better world through unity and shared joy.
